Simulation Of Heterogeneous Pedestrian Dynamics Based On Group Behavior

Study on the simulation of pedestrian flow is widely used in the field of group dynamics, social science, structural engineering and so on, which can through the way of evaluation prediction and retrieval research guide the planning and design of pedestrian traffic facilities, to circumvent facilities exist in hidden spots, a reasonable guide for pedestrian flow and avoid the pedestrian stampede accident. For example, the pedestrian traffic facilities planning, design and evaluation, the large pedestrian cluster gathering place like traffic hub station, gymnasium, business center of safe evacuation design work, etc. Combined with previous pedestrian stampede accident analysis can be found that the cause of accident is often is the specific pedestrians in line flow of individual local behavior continues to spread, finally caused irreversible crowded stampede, so for the simulation study of pedestrian flow also need emphatically to focus on the specific pedestrian attributes of the differences to focus attention. And the simulation study generally see pedestrians as strategy is exactly the same properties and behavior of individuals, which makes the simulation model is easy to understand, calculation efficiency, but weakened the contribution of individual characteristics on the pedestrian group dynamics, the differentiation of pedestrian attribute needs to be further researched urgently in the influence on the pedestrian group dynamics; and for existed generally in the population of meso pedestrian peer group, nowadays only in the present research on the physical properties was expounded, is still a lack of its social attribute level interpretation of features, and therefore also need further exploration.This article first from the beginning of the pedestrian simulation research situation at home and abroad, microscopic simulation model for pedestrians and the pedestrian simulation platform are reviewed, and the characteristics of pedestrian activity extraction method and classification are introduced, and the original social force model is calibration;Then the pedestrian attribute data of different gender and age of the pedestrian for classification statistics and quantitative and the corresponding differentiation treatment was conducted on the maneuverable attribute of the monomers pedestrians model, to enhance the ability of model description of pedestrian differentiated attribute. For the part of companion group model introduced differentiated members of the combination of morphology, enhanced the scope of application of the model and authenticity, and corresponding to explore the effects of heterogeneous mechanism of group dynamics. In addition add the packet communication mechanism for pedestrians peer group model, emersion on the level of its social attribute for the packet communication behavior and corresponding analyses companion group of pedestrians in the process of marching self-organization form change behavior on its dynamic mechanism; Finally, this article based on the above research content integration, set up a differentiated pedestrian simulation platform, and designed a variety of simulation scenario, motion simulation for the different component types and properties of the pedestrian flow and statistical analysis of experimental results, obtained the differentiation properties of pedestrian flow that impact on its overall performance, and further analyzes the self-organization to pedestrian flow movement rules to establish the impact of the mechanism.
